Enterprise visual generative AI platform

Bria is a visual generative AI platform for enterprise teams that need image and video generation with more control over outputs, deployment, and commercial usage terms. The site positions it for professional creative workflows where brand consistency, predictability, and compliance matter.

The platform centers on Visual Generative Language, or VGL, a structured way to specify visual parameters such as lighting, camera angle, composition, background, and objects. Bria says this approach is intended to reduce prompt ambiguity and make results more repeatable across code pipelines, CI/CD workflows, and other production systems.

Core capabilities

Controllable visual generation

Bria’s homepage centers on controllable generation, where users can specify lighting, camera, composition, and objects explicitly instead of relying on open-ended prompts.

Structured Visual Generative Language

The platform uses Visual Generative Language, a structured format designed for deterministic instructions and consistent output across runs.

Image and video workflow support

The pricing page lists image generation, image editing, video editing, product-shot workflows, and live video streaming capabilities across the platform.

Commercial-use protections

Bria says its models are trained on licensed data and that eligible plans include full IP and privacy indemnity, with compliance claims including SOC 2 Type II, ISO 27001, GDPR, and the EU AI Act.

Fine-tuning and model access

The pricing page shows self-service fine-tuning through a playground or API, along with source code and model weights on higher tiers.

Multiple integration paths

The platform is offered through API, MCP, ComfyUI, embedded iFrame, Figma, SDKs, and other deployment options for developer and creative workflows.

Pros and Cons

Pros

  • Supports both image and video workflows on one platform.
  • Offers structured prompting through VGL for more explicit control than open-ended prompting.
  • Provides multiple integration options, including API, MCP, ComfyUI, embedded iFrame, Figma, and SDKs.
  • Includes deployment choices from hosted cloud to BYOC, on-premise, and air-gapped environments.
  • States licensed training data and commercial-use protections, which are important for enterprise content production.

Cons

  • The site provides limited public detail on implementation depth for each integration surface, so teams may need to evaluate the fit directly.
  • Pricing for Business and Enterprise is custom, so public comparison is limited.
  • The homepage and pricing page are broad on capability claims, but they do not provide exhaustive technical specifications for every model or workflow.

FAQ

Is Bria’s output safe to use commercially?

Yes. The pricing and homepage content state that Bria trains its models exclusively on licensed data and offers full IP indemnification for eligible plans. The site also says its output is covered for commercial use.

How can Bria be integrated into a workflow?

The pricing page says Bria can be used through API, MCP, ComfyUI, embedded iFrame, and Figma, with options for SDK-based integration as well. The homepage also describes integration into code pipelines, CI/CD workflows, and version control through VGL.

What is VGL?

Bria presents VGL, or Visual Generative Language, as a structured way to specify visual parameters such as lighting, camera angle, composition, background, and objects. The homepage says it is meant to reduce prompt ambiguity and make results more consistent across runs.

Is there a trial or free plan?

The pricing page shows a free trial with 100 free generations and access to the platform, including API services, ComfyUI nodes, and self-service fine-tuning. Paid plans then move from development usage to business and enterprise deployment.

Where can Bria be deployed?

The site says Bria can run on Bria Cloud, on your own cloud through BYOC on AWS or Azure, on-premise, or in a fully air-gapped setup. The deployment choice depends on the plan and your infrastructure needs.
